    • 4 Saintmetal // Oct 24, 2008

      No, you will not. You have to understand that protein is the building blocks of muscle, so if you dont work the muscles your muscles cant rebuild themselves. In order to rebuild your muscles, you will have to start a weight lifting workout and if you do it intensely on a regular basis (3 times a week) you will force your muscles to grow fast.
